Reflections has been my 99 year old Mom's home for more than a year now and I have to say the entire team have performed above and beyond all of our expectations. Mom has consistantly told us she's very happy there. I know for a fact she was not always happy during the previous 5 years that we cared for her in our home-- which left us very frustrated and exhausted. Tho the Covid 19 isolation has been stressful for all of us we have the peace of mind that she's still being exceptionally well cared for -- the whole team is excellent!! -- Jeannie Smith, RN

Placing a loved one in a residential memory care facility can be a heart-wrenching decision: family dynamics are disrupted, emotions can run high, and myriad details seem to demand immediate attention. So needless to say, when my father made the decision 15 months ago to place my mom in residence at Reflections in Washington IL, the decision was not taken lightly and was met with trepidation. Will she be well cared for here, I wondered?During my unannounced visits with Mom, I have consistently found her to be well-tended, engaged, and content with her surroundings. I've asked her more than once, 'Are you happy here?' Her response has always been, 'Yes.' And gratefully, her degree of cognition still assures me she would answer differently, if that were the case.About seven months ago, I took pictures of my mom, the grounds, and the indoor facilities at Reflections, to send to relatives in Germany. They were comforted to see the quality of life she has and to know she is in good hands.I have played Bingo with Mom and the other residents on more than one occasion, lounged with them in comfortable outdoor furniture on the lanai, and slow-danced with Mom, as a Karaoke singer entertained the residents, during the holiday season.During the Covid-19 pandemic, effective, methodical, and extensive measures were taken early on, to ensure the residents' safety and well-being. To date and to the best of my knowledge, Reflections has been and remains an infection-free residence. And that alone says a good deal to me.When it comes down to it, though, it's always a bit of a leap of faith, isn't it? In my ongoing experience, I am grateful to say my faith hasn't been misplaced in Reflections and its caring staff.With heartfelt gratitude,David S.
